Influence of the COVID-19 pandemic on the incidence of eating disorders

Introduction: Eating disorders (EDs) develop more frequently in young females. Following the COVID-19 pandemic, there has been evidence of an increase in children and adolescents, with an earlier onset and a worse body weight and nutritional status.
